The New York City Transit Authority

The New York City Transit Authority has stopped deal with some capital building and construction projects as a result of the guv's decision to stop congestion pricing. The MTA states it should now find another way to fund its multi-year, $51.5 billion capital plan, which consists of projects like track repair work and the extension of the Second Avenue subway line. In addition, the MTA will likewise likely forfeit a $2 billion grant from the federal government that would assist support the job.

The MTA's chair, Janno Lieber, said the agency is striving to find a solution. Nevertheless, he stressed that the MTA will not abandon the Second Avenue extension project. Lieber likewise urged state legislators to approve the MTA's strategy by New Year's Day or the agency will be forced to postpone important subway maintenance and other facilities tasks.

In a statement, Lieber worried that the MTA will "continue to focus on state-of-good-repair projects, consisting of track and signal repairs, security video cameras, availability renovations, and zero-emission bus purchases." He included that the MTA will "work carefully with federal transportation authorities" in an effort to salvage the $3.4 billion grant from the federal government that supports stage 2 of the Second Avenue subway.

The guv's relocate to pause congestion prices has actually left the MTA with a gaping hole in its operating budget, which covers payroll and other day-to-day costs. According to the MTA's own estimates, the pause will reduce the MTA's operating budget plan by more than $1.5 billion this year and trigger the MTA to defer tens of millions in upkeep and debt-service costs.

New York is the world's most-congested metropolitan location, according to traffic data analysis company INRIX Inc. The business states drivers in the city area lost 101 hours to traffic throughout peak travelling times in 2018. That expense commuters $9.1 billion. The New York City Department of Transportation (DOT) is responsible for managing much of the city's transportation infrastructure, including street signs, traffic signals, and street lights. The DOT is also responsible for street resurfacing, pothole repair work, parking meter installation and maintenance, and community parking facility management. It also operates the Staten Island Ferry.
